Low or dirty transmission fluid can cause problems, including a whining noise when accelerating. Pop open the hood, locate the transmission dipstick, and check the level and condition of the fluid. If it’s low, top it up with the recommended fluid type for your vehicle.

Low fluid level. Insufficient transmission fluid level is one of the foremost causes of clicking transmission. The fluid is meant to lubricate the transmission system and prevent overheating. Running on a low fluid level will cause metal parts in the transmission system to produce a clicking sound due to a lack of proper lubrication.No more noise even on the incline. One of the most common transfer case problems in older GM trucks, built between the years 1988 and 2000, is they tend to produce a transfer case grinding noise at some point in their functional lives.This typically happens when the driver tries to switch between 2WD and 4WD.

A faulty MAF sensor can cause all kinds of driveability issues: hesitation during acceleration. lack of power. misfires. surges. The most common problem withthe MAF sensor is dirt trapped inside the sensor, usually around the hot wire. Often, using a MAF sensor cleaner will help restore proper operation.

Pushrods connect the camshaft to the lifters. If they bend, it will usually cause a horrible ticking sound. 3. Oiling Issues. It is possible for a lifter to tick if it is not given enough oil, if the oil is too dirty, or if it is too old.

Jump to Latest Follow 21 - 34 of 34 Posts. 1 ...In the mornings or when the engine is cold, the oil has had the chance, due to gravity to drain out of these back down into the oil pan. When you start the engine when it is cold, this can produce a ticking sound as you describe. This happens as the lifters are moving without oil initially.Instagram:https://instagram. food lion 171dumb charades difficult movieswho's got warrants minnehaha countyfancy cursive tattoos Run a can of seafoam through the intake.
